The Role of the Senior CNC Programmer:

The Senior Programmer will spend a high majority of their time, "hands-on" in the development and implementation of programs used on CNC machine tools, including many wide and varied manufacturing processes. The Senior Programmer will use his/her knowledge and experience of engineering and manufacturing to help introduce and integrate new products smoothly into manufacture.

The Main Tasks of CNC Programmer are Outlined Below:

Using various CAM packages including SmartCAM and GibbsCAM the Senior Programmer's role will include creating, implementing, and maintaining programs for use on various manufacturing processes.
Using Creo (ProEngineer), the role demands the Senior Programmer to be proficient at interrogating models to produce programs for complex machined profiles on milling, turning and turn/mill machines.
The role will require programs and methodologies to be developed for various manufacturing processes using the specific and bespoke software.
To ensure all routings are accurate, simple to understand and up to date, routed cost effectively. Undertaking estimating of product costs for sales will build this knowledge.
Assist with compiling machining time for quoting for new work including undertaking estimating of product costs for sales and directors as appropriate.
Support Engineering activities when necessary.

Skills and Abilities:

Ability to understand various machine and process protocols (ideally Fanuc, Okuma, Mazak, Mitsubishi, etc.),
It is essential that the person can validate generated software program and make productive modifications to them when and where necessary as part of ongoing continuous improvement.
Ability to demonstrate extensive engineering knowledge, from primary forming processes, through to realisation of end product.

Knowledge/Experience:

He/she will have served a practical engineering apprenticeship.
He/she will have previously held an engineering production/manufacturing role and gained significant experience post apprenticeship.
Proven track record of using computers and computer software packages to generate CNC programmes.
Has excellent understanding of engineering drawings, geometrical tolerancing and dimensioning.
Has an excellent understanding of engineering tooling required to manufacture engineering components.
Drawings, geometrical tolerancing and dimensioning.
Tools, cutters, inserts and work holding methodology both existing and emerging.
Engineering materials including stainless steel and some exotics such as Inconel, Super Duplex and Titanium, and able to optimise the cutting performance and processing of such materials.
